Located on Mashtots Avenue, the HayArt Cultural Center welcomes visitors to explore dynamic exhibitions of contemporary art and attend cultural events. It frequently hosts both international and local artists, making it an excellent stop for art enthusiasts looking to engage with Armenia’s vibrant, modern creative scene.




Since its establishment in the late 1990s, the “HayArt” Cultural Center has cultivated a reputation as a vibrant municipal hub dedicated to showcasing the breadth of contemporary art. The center features a diverse and ambitious program, spanning large-scale installations, international exhibitions, and compelling modern artistic expressions.
Because its calendar of shows, festivals, and multimedia projects is frequently refreshed—with new events and featured artists rotated regularly—it ensures that both repeat visitors and first-time guests always have something new and stimulating to discover. This dynamic programming makes “HayArt” a key destination for art enthusiasts looking to immerse themselves in Armenia’s contemporary and experimental art scene.








What sets “HayArt” apart is its essential dual function: it is not just an exhibition space, but also a dynamic, multifunctional platform for diverse cultural programming. The center’s team curates and hosts a wide array of events, including large-scale contemporary art exhibitions, international festivals, film screenings, and performing arts. This is a crucial role, making it a vital partner for the Yerevan Municipality and a nexus for international cultural exchange.
This expertise makes “HayArt” a truly trusted resource for local and international artists, curators, and cultural organizations seeking a high-profile, professional venue for their most ambitious projects. From hosting the International Print Biennale to organizing workshops and cultural debates, the center ensures every event fosters a vibrant dialogue between different art forms, artists, and the public.
